What exactly Wagering Requirements Really Mean

Wagering requirements, often called playthrough or turnover, indicate how many times you must bet a bonus amount before you can withdraw any winnings linked to it. If you receive a $200 bonus with a 30x requirement, you need to place $6,000 in eligible bets. That number does not represent a penalty, but it represents the casino’s way of stopping players from depositing, claiming a match, and cashing out instantly. At God of Wins Casino, we consistently verify whether the multiplier is applied to the bonus only or to the deposit plus bonus, because that small detail alters the total dramatically.

A common example we find across Australian-facing casinos is a 100% deposit match up to $500 https://casinogodofwins.com/bonus. Some promotions list a 35x wagering requirement on the bonus only, while others apply it to the bonus plus deposit. On a $500 deposit with a $500 bonus, bonus-only wagering equals $17,500 of required play, but bonus-plus-deposit wagering increases to $35,000. That represents a massive difference for the same headline number. We consistently inquire: does the multiplier cover just the free money or the combined amount? If the terms do not answer that clearly, we treat the offer with caution.

Cashback offers and Reload Promotions: Do They Adhere to the Same Conditions?

Cashback promotions are the underrated stars of the casino promo world, and they often come with much friendlier wagering terms than deposit matches. A typical cashback offer returns a percentage of your net losses over a set period, generally between 5% and 20%. Some cashback is paid as real cash with no wagering at all, which is gold for players who dislike locked balances. At God of Wins Casino, we always check whether cashback arrives as withdrawable funds or as a bonus with its own playthrough. That specific detail determines whether the offer is genuinely useful or simply another requirement.

Reload offers sit somewhere in the middle of welcome offers and cashback. They are intended to reward existing players who make additional deposits, usually with a lower match percentage and a smaller maximum amount. Wagering on reloads can range from 20x to 40x, but we hardly ever see the extreme 50x-plus requirements that sometimes appear on big welcome packages. Because reload deals are typically smaller, clearing them feels more manageable. We still read the terms with the same care, because a reload bonus with a 10% game contribution on your favourite pokie can be a waste.

One thing we value about cashback at God of Wins Casino is that the best offers distinguish your cashback from your deposit bonus. If a single deposit triggers both, the wagering requirement may apply to the combined amount, making the cashback less beneficial. We favor promotions where cashback is calculated after wagering is complete or paid as a separate credit. That way you are certain of what you are getting. For Australian players who deposit regularly, a dependable low-wager or zero-wager cashback deal usually surpasses one big welcome bonus that comes with a mountain of turnover.

Real-time Dealer, Table Games and the Standard Contribution Trap

The largest contribution trap we see is live dealer play. Players claim a bonus, launch a live blackjack or roulette table, and begin betting without realising that most online casinos assign a 0% contribution to live dealer games. Every dollar you wager there is ineffective to reduce your playthrough. That can be a nasty shock when the time limit expires and your balance is still locked. At most Australian-facing sites, we consistently recommend treating live dealer as a no-go zone for clearing any standard welcome bonus unless the terms explicitly state otherwise.

Roulette is another typical offender. Even standard online roulette often applies 10% or less, and certain bets like even-money outside wagers may be excluded entirely because they can be mixed to reduce variance. We have observed players build up hundreds in roulette bets and barely reduce their wagering. If you prefer table games, our recommendation is to complete the bonus on pokies first and then move to blackjack or roulette with your real balance. That way you avoid carrying playthrough requirements into games that barely affect the needle.

How to Interpret a Bonus Terms Box Without Overlooking

We have each clicked through a terms box in less than five seconds, but that is where the real bonus lives. The opening line we check is the minimum deposit, because playing with less can void the entire offer. Then we look for the maximum bet rule, which often sits between $5 and $10 while a bonus is active. Bet over that limit and you could forfeit the bonus and winnings. Time limits also matter more than most players expect. Many Australian online casinos give you between 7 and 30 days to complete wagering, and we have seen numerous players lose a bonus simply because they ran out of time.

Another detail we never skip is game weighting. A bonus might look generous until you discover that pokies contribute 100% but blackjack contributes only 10%. If you are a table game fan, a 35x requirement on a bonus can feel more like 350x in practical terms. We also read the withdrawal policy carefully. Some operators require you to make a small deposit or verify your identity before approving any cash-out from a free spin win. At God of Wins Casino, we rate transparency higher than raw size, because a smaller bonus with clear terms often beats a big one buried under restrictions.

  • Minimum deposit and eligible payment methods
  • Playthrough multiplier and whether it covers bonus only or bonus plus deposit
  • Game weighting percentages for pokies, table games, and live dealer
  • Maximum bet allowed during active wagering
  • Time limit to complete playthrough
  • Cash-out limits on bonus winnings

Free Spins Aren’t Invariably as Simple as They Look

Complimentary spins appear as the most straightforward deal in any digital casino, but the small print can rapidly transform a exciting bonus into disappointment. The key clause is whether winnings from free spins are awarded as actual funds or as promotional credits. Whenever free spin gains are given as bonus money, they almost always come with a wagering requirement, typically from 20x and 40x. A group of 50 free spins can produce $30 in profits, which then demands $900 or more in turnover before you can cash out a cent. We consistently review that condition before we start playing.

Another pitfall with free spins is the game restriction. Many free spin promotions are attached to one particular slot machine, and if you start a alternate game, the spins may be void or the gains may not apply. The cashout cap on free spin payouts can also be unexpectedly low, at times capped at $50 or $100. We have observed players land a big win from free spins only to find out they can withdraw only a minor portion. At God of Wins Casino, we search for free spin promotions with no maximum cap or at least a well-defined, fair cap before recommending them.

Free spins usually lapse fast, frequently within 24 to 72 hours. That short period obliges you to activate them before you have a chance to consider about strategy. If the spins themselves come with a distinct wagering requirement, the deadline can be even tighter. We prefer to view free spins as a minor tryout rather than a significant money maker. Activate them, spin them, and read the terms on winnings before adding more. A bit of caution here can save you from chasing a withdrawal that is never going to happen.

Why a 30x Wagering Requirement Is Not the Same at Every Casino

We often hear players compare bonuses by wagering multiplier only, but that is like evaluating a car by its paint colour. Two casinos can each advertise a 30x reddit.com playthrough, yet one bonus completes in a weekend while the other becomes a grind. The reason boils down to contribution rates. At one site, 100% of every pokies spin applies toward the requirement, while at another the same game might count 70% or even 50%. A lower contribution percentage means you must stake more real money to reach that same turnover target.

Maximum cashout caps also alter the value. A no deposit bonus with 30x wagering sounds fine until you see that winnings are capped at $100. That means even if you clear playthrough and have $400 in your balance, you only receive $100. We also evaluate whether a bonus is sticky or non-sticky. curated list Sticky bonuses are removed from your balance when you withdraw, while non-sticky bonuses let you keep the bonus amount once cleared. These structural differences mean a 30x deal at God of Wins Casino may be worth far more than a 30x deal elsewhere, even though the headline number is identical.

The Games That Truly Help Clear a Bonus

To clear a wagering requirement effectively, pokies are almost always your best weapon. At many Australian online casinos, online slots provide 100% of every bet toward playthrough, which keeps the math straightforward. That is why we recommend beginning with high-RTP pokies when a bonus is active. Games such as book-type slots and classic fruit machines usually count fully and let you fulfill the required turnover without extra contribution penalties. Just remember that progressive slots are sometimes excluded, so we always examine the restricted games list before spinning.

Table games and video poker are much less useful for clearing a typical bonus. Blackjack, roulette, and baccarat often contribute between 0% and 20%, depending on the casino. That means a $10 blackjack hand might only register as $2 or even nothing toward your wagering. We realize why casinos do this: table games have a much lower house edge, so they open the operator to bonus abuse. For players who love blackjack, we suggest either looking for a table-specific bonus or accepting that clearing the welcome offer on blackjack alone is usually impractical.

A Clear Walkthrough of Completing a Typical Welcome Bonus

Allow us to walk through a concrete example to ensure the entire process seems less abstract. Imagine you sign up at God of Wins Casino and claim a 100% match bonus up to $300 on your first deposit, with a 35x wagering requirement on the bonus amount only. You deposit $300 and receive a $300 bonus. Your required turnover is $10,500. That means every eligible bet you place reduces that number until it hits zero. It sounds like a lot, but on a fast pokie with small spins, it can clear in a few sessions.

We handle every welcome bonus with a plan rather than hope. First, we confirm that the pokie we want to play appears on the eligible games list and contributes 100%. Then we set a bet size that keeps us under the maximum allowed while the bonus is active. We also avoid depositing more than the matched amount, because extra real funds beyond the match can sit behind the wagering wall if the system applies playthrough to the whole balance. A disciplined approach makes clearing a welcome bonus feel like a game rather than a chore.

  1. Deposit exactly the amount needed to claim the match and no more.
  2. Open a high-RTP online pokie that contributes 100%.
  3. Keep your bet size below the maximum allowed during wagering.
  4. Check your remaining wagering progress in the bonus dashboard if available.
  5. Stop playing if you hit a solid win and check the withdrawal rules before continuing.

Steering clear of Common Wagering Pitfalls at Australian Online Casinos

The most expensive mistake we see Australian players make is chasing a bonus after landing a big win. Once your balance is well above the original deposit, the wagering requirement may still be incomplete, but continuing to play can eliminate that win. We always recommend monitoring your progress before chasing. If you are close to clearing, a slower pace safeguards your balance. If you are far away, it is often better to acknowledge the loss of the bonus than to endanger your real winnings on high-variance spins that can vanish quickly.

Another common pitfall is using payment methods that bar you from bonuses. Some Australian online casinos do not allow bonus claims when you deposit with certain e-wallets or prepaid cards. We have seen players deposit via Skrill or Neteller, only to find the welcome offer was not credited because the method was in the excluded list. Always verify the deposit method terms before you transfer funds. Also avoid taking a new bonus while you still have an active one, as stacking promotions can combine wagering requirements and make clearing nearly impossible.

Time limits snare more players than any other term. A 30-day window sounds generous until life gets in the way and you realise the bonus expires tomorrow. We set a simple reminder when we take any offer at God of Wins Casino, then plan sessions around the deadline. Steer clear of betting above the maximum during the final push, even if you are frustrated. One oversized bet can nullify the entire bonus and all winnings. Sticking to the rules is always easier than debating with support after the fact, especially when the terms were clear from the start.
